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

Командные прерывания



INT n Осуществляется переход к программе обработки прерываний по адресу, указанному в n-ом элементе таблицы векторов прерываний
INTO Равносильна команде INT 4, выполняется, если произошло переполнение (OF=1)
IRET Возврат из программы обработки прерываний

Команды управления процессором

CLC Сброс флага переноса
CMC Инверсия флага переноса
STC Установка флага переноса
CLD Сброс флага направления
STD Установка флага направления
CLI Запрет внешних прерываний
STI Разрешение внешних прерываний
CTS Сброс флага переключения задач
HLT Останов
LOCK Префикс блокировки шины
NOP Холостая команда
WAIT (FWAIT) Синхронизация с арифметическим сопроцессором

Команды обработки последовательности кодов

REP Префикс повторения, следующая за ним операция повторяется, пока содержимое ЕСХ не станет равным нулю
REPE, REPZ Дополнительное условие повторения – выполнять, пока ZF=1
REPNE, REPNZ Дополнительное условие повторения – выполнять, пока ZF=0
MOVS dest,src Команда передает код из цепочки, адресуемой через DS:[ESI] по адресам, указанным в ES:[EDI]
LODS src Команда загрузки цепочки в аккумулятор
STOS dest Обратная LODS
SCAS dest Команда сканирования цепочки
CMPS dest,src Команда сравнения цепочек




Дата публикования: 2015-10-09; Прочитано: 351 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2024 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.006 с)...